Natural Gas has been on a tear

Natural Gas has been buoyed by the cold weather hitting the South and the Northeast of the US while stockpiles had been low. Cold conditions are now expected to continue throughout November, so this fuelled the upward move in Natural Gas.

Natural Gas eventually sold off yesterday after there was a surprise build in inventories as they rose by 39bcf as opposed to the 33bcf expected. See here for yesterday's release.

The 1 hour chart below shows the 200EMA proving good support for Natural Gas. Expect the 100 and 200 EMA to keep providing support for now as East Coast temperatures are expected to remain below normal until November 25.

Meanwhile the Stockpiles are 16% below their 5 year average and 14% below the previous years.
